React - La Guía Completa - Hooks Redux Context +15 Proyectos
Descripción
El único curso que enseña REACT SIN CONOCIMIENTO PREVIO HASTA LOS TEMAS MÁS AVANZADOS! COMPLETAMENTE REGRABADO PARA APRENDER HOOKS, CONTEXT Y REDUX! Creando más de 15 proyectos
React es una librería JavaScript desarrollada por Facebook para crear Interfaces Web y Aplicaciones Interactivas y con flujo de datos más complejo que jQuery o JavaScript.
Aprender React sin duda te hará mejor desarrollador Web y JavaScript, es una libreria que nos permite escribir código de JavaScript Moderno hoy en dia.
En este curso aprenderás esta librería creando múltiples proyectos del Mundo Real.
Los Proyectos que desarrollaremos son:
Administrador de Biblioteca con Redux y Cloud Firestore
Buscador de Eventos con EventBrite API y Fetch API
Buscador de Imágenes con Pixabay API
Aplicación CRUD con React Router, JSON Server y Axios
Cotizador de Criptomonedas
Portal de Noticias con News API
Administrador de Citas de Veterinaria con React y Local Storage
Gasto y Presupuesto Semanal
Aplicación de Clima con Fetch API
Cotizador de Seguro de Autos con múltiples Modelos, Marcas y Tipo de Seguro.
Portal de Bitcoin con Noticias, Cotización y Próximos Eventos con NextJS
Autenticación de Usuarios con JWT y Auth0
Frases de Breaking Bad
Buscador de Letras e Información de Bandas músicales.
Si nunca has escrito código React pero tienes deseos de aprenderlo, estas en el curso adecuado, asumo que nunca has escrito una sola linea de React.
¿No has escrito código JavaScript o escribiste JavaScript en las versiones anteriores y no lo recuerdas? El curso también incluye una Introducción / Recordatorio a JavaScript!
¿Que Aprenderé en el Curso?
1.- Introducción al Curso y Proyectos que construiremos
Veremos todo lo que aprenderás en el curso de React JS
2.- JavaScript - Introducción / Recordatorio, ¿Cuanto JavaScript debo saber para aprender React?
Al ser React una librería JavaScript, lo ideal es tener algo de conocimiento en este lenguaje, ya sea que nunca hayas escrito una línea de JavaScript o lo hayas hecho hace tiempo, este capítulo contiene todo lo que debes saber antes de comenzar con ReactJS
3.- Instalando NodeJS, NPM y create-react-app
Muchos cursos te enseñarán a crear un workflow con Webpack y extender así la duración del curso, create-react-app ya tiene todo lo que necesitas, por lo tanto crearemos los proyectos con esta herramienta.
4.- Introducción Básicos de React
Comenzaremos a Escribir el código básico de React, veremos que es JSX, Componentes, distintos tipos de Componentes, Props, State, términos que son nuevos y existen en React, una base sólida antes de comenzar a crear proyectos más avanzados.
5.- PROYECTO: Administrador de Pacientes de Veterinaria - Class Components
El 95% del código de React esta hecho con Class Components, si Hooks hacen todo más sencillo, pero como desarrollador React es importante que conozcas también los Class Components,
Este será nuestro primer proyecto en React, crearemos un proyecto con un formulario de contacto donde daremos de alta pacientes de veterinaria e información extra, todo se va a almacenar en Local Storage para que los datos se guarden incluso refrescando la ventana, un proyecto más complejo para aprender React
6.- PROYECTO: Sitio Web de Noticias desde una REST API - Class Components
Será nuestro primer Proyecto con una API Externa, una de tus actividades que tendrás como desarrollador de React será consumir una API con un backend como PHP, Java, C#, Python o Node, y en este curso comenzarás a consumir una API.
7.- PROYECTO: Buscador de Eventos con EventBrite API y React - Context API
Un proyecto más desde una aplicación externa, donde mostraremos los resultados desde una REST API externa como es la de EventBrite, veremos las ventajas de utilizar Context API que esta disponible desde React 16.3
8.- PROYECTO: Aplicación de Clima con REST API - React Hooks
Veamos como utilizar Hooks y también que son para crear nuestras aplicaciones, consumiremos una API donde leeremos los datos del formulario y enviar el REQUEST hacia la API y finalmente mostrar el resultado.
9.- PROYECTO: Administrador de Pacientes - React Hooks
La forma de aprender React Hooks es tomando un proyecto que ya tengas como Class Components y lo realices con Hooks, así que veremos como transformar un proyecto ya existente en Hooks!
10.- PROYECTO: Frases de Breaking Bad - React Hooks
Veamos como utilizar React Hooks para llamar la API desde un botón, así como mostrar los resultados de frases de la serie de Breaking Bad.
11.- PROYECTO: Buscador de Letras Musicales e información de Bandas o Grupos de Música - React Hooks
En este capítulo crearemos un buscador, si buscas por un artista y una canción la API nos retornará la letra de ella, además haremos una segunda consulta a otra API para obtener más información sobre una banda en especifico.
12.- PROYECTO: Cotizador de Criptomonedas con React y Axios - React Hooks
Fetch es genial, pero axios hace las consultas a REST API's mucho más fácil en React, veremos como obtener el precio actual de una gran cantidad de criptomonedas con solo presionar un botón y diferentes monedas tradicionales.
13.- PROYECTO: Buscador de Imágenes con Pixabay - React Hooks.
En este proyecto utilizaremos la API de Pixabay para realizar una búsqueda de imágenes que puedes utilizar en tus proyectos y descargarlas, además veremos como crear un paginador en React.
14.- PROYECTO: Operaciones CRUD con Axios, Sweet Alert 2, React Router y JSON Server - React Hooks
En algunas ocasiones será necesario crear una aplicación CRUD - Crear, Leer, Actualizar y Eliminar registros en React, utilizaremos una REST API que nos permitirá simular estas acciones muy fácilmente, la vamos a configurar con JSON Server y el proyecto estará hecho con React Hooks.
15.- PROYECTO: Autenticación en React con JWT, Auth0 y un Servidor Express (NodeJS)
En este capítulo veremos como crear un servidor en Express (NodeJS) que nos permitirá mostrar una serie de Productos que vamos a consumir en nuestro Cliente (Aplicación de React) utilizando un servicio de Autenticación llamado Auth0, además, veremos como validar un JWT y autenticar usuarios con JSON Web Tokens
16.- PROYECTO: Portal Bitcoin con Noticias, Cotización y Próximos Eventos en NextJS
SSR o Server Side Rendering, permitirá mostrar el contenido utilizando el servidor y no el cliente (como hacen todas las aplicaciones en react)
Esto ayudará al Performance, también a mejorar el SEO, y el mejor proyecto es NEXTJS, veamos como utilizarlo!
17.- Introducción a REDUX
En este capítulo veremos una introducción a Redux, que es el store, actions y reducers, y todos los términos que son necesarios para comenzar a dominar Redux.
18.- PROYECTO: Administrador de Citas para Veterinaria con REDUX y LocalStorage
En este capítulo tomaremos un proyecto de los ya existentes y veremos como transformarlo en una aplicación con Redux, así podrás ver las diferencias entre un proyecto con State y Props y uno con Redux para el state, así como Hooks, ya que este proyecto se realiza con Classes, Hooks y Redux en el curso.
19.- PROYECTO: CRUD con React, Redux, REST API y Axios
Crearemos un proyecto con una REST API y React y Redux desde cero, utilizaremos AXIOS porque será un CRUD (Crear, Leer, Actualizar y Eliminar Registros con estas 4 tecnologías)
20: PROYECTO: Creando una App con Firestore / Firebase, React y Redux
En este capítulo veremos como crear una Aplicación con Firestore / Firebase, tendrá la Base de datos en tiempo real, autenticación de usuarios y veremos como unir 2 colecciones para hacerla más dinamica e interactiva.
¿Para quién es este curso?
Si ya has tomado un curso en React pero te dejo más dudas que otra cosa, este curso es para ti, iremos paso a paso introduciendo temas nuevos y cada vez más complejos
Desarrolladores y Programadores Web que desean incorporar React a sus habilidades
Desarrolladores que deseen aprender la Librería más popular para Aplicaciones Modernas con JavaScript
Si eres de las personas que aprenden más desarrollando proyectos reales, este curso es para ti, incluimos más de 10 Proyectos!
Si eres de las personas que aprenden con cursos paso a paso, escribiendo código sin prisas y sabiendo que sucede, este curso es para ti,
React es una de las librerías mejor pagadas, cualquier persona que desee obtener un ingreso mayor debe tomar este curso
Requisitos
Si has escrito HTML, CSS y JavaScript y deseas aprender React, estas en el curso Adecuado
Incluso si no has escrito Código JavaScript Moderno ( ES6+ ) el curso tiene una sección de JavaScript antes de comenzar con React
No es necesario conocimientos previos en React asumo que nunca has escrito una sola línea de React!
React - La Guía Completa - Hooks Redux Context +15 Proyectos[MG]
19.33 GB | 25.5 hs de clases | udemy | 7zip | 06/2019 |Idioma:Español
Si fallan los enlaces por favor repórtalos con un comentario líneas abajo.
Está es la versión actualizada a junio, no tiene la actualización de agosto:(
ResponderEliminarexcelente aporte podrias subir este curso es muy bueno
ResponderEliminarhttps://www.udemy.com/disenador-web-profesional-de-intermedio-a-experto/